5. Understanding All the Forces at Play

Concept

The second element of the Leadership Point-of-View (LPV) is “understanding all the forces at play.” Many who are promoted out of a functional leadership responsibility continue to see the world primarily from their comfortable mental platform—their historical experience. Executives who come from operations are likely to be most concerned about efficiencies, productivity, fixed assets, and supply chains. Executives who come out of finance are likely to focus mostly on balance sheets, equity, operating ratios, stock price, and the economy.
